Pair Trading with Singapore ReinsuranceLimit and AAC TECHNOLOGHLDGADR

The main advantage of trading using opposite Singapore ReinsuranceLimit and AAC TECHNOLOGHLDGADR posit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Singapore ReinsuranceLimit position performs unexpectedly, AAC TECHNOLOGHLDGADR can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in AAC TECHNOLOGHLDGADR will offset losses from the drop in AAC TECHNOLOGHLDGADR's long position.
The idea behind Singapore Reinsurance and AAC TECHNOLOGHLDGADR p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side). This can be achieved by designing a pairs trade with two highly correlated stocks or equities that operate in a similar space or sector, making it possible to obtain profits through simple and relatively low-risk investment.
